Start your day by exploring the beautiful Hadimba Temple, dedicated to Goddess Hadimba. The temple's unique architecture amidst the cedar forest is a sight to behold.
Hadimba Temple is located in the Old Manali area, a short drive from the main town center.
Embark on a day trip to Solang Valley for adventure activities like paragliding, zorbing, and skiing (seasonal). The breathtaking views of snow-capped mountains are a highlight.
Solang Valley is about 30 minutes drive from Manali town.
Explore the Vashisht Temple and take a dip in the natural hot springs for a rejuvenating experience. The temple's architecture and tranquil surroundings are worth exploring.
Vashisht Temple and Hot Springs are a short drive from Old Manali.
Embark on a scenic drive from Manali to Keylong, the administrative center of Lahaul and Spiti district. Enjoy the stunning landscapes and mountain views along the way.
Keylong is approximately 120 km from Manali and takes around 6-7 hours by road.
Embark on a picturesque journey from Keylong to Kaza, the largest town in Spiti Valley. Marvel at the rugged landscapes and barren beauty of the region.
Kaza is approximately 200 km from Keylong and takes around 8-9 hours by road.
Embark on an excursion to the picturesque villages of Langza, Komic, and Hikkim. Explore the ancient monasteries, get a glimpse of village life, and don't miss sending a postcard from the world's highest post office in Hikkim.
The villages are accessible by road from Kaza and offer stunning views of the Spiti Valley.

Embark on a scenic drive from Kaza to Tabo, known for its ancient Tabo Monastery, one of the oldest continuously operating Buddhist monasteries in the Himalayas.
Tabo is approximately 50 km from Kaza and takes around 2 hours by road.
Discover the rich history and spiritual significance of Tabo Monastery, also known as the 'Ajanta of the Himalayas'. Marvel at the ancient frescoes and sculptures.
Tabo Monastery is a short walk from the main town area.
Embark on a scenic drive from Tabo to Reckong Peo, the district headquarters of Kinnaur. Enjoy the picturesque landscapes and apple orchards along the way.
Reckong Peo is approximately 170 km from Tabo and takes around 6-7 hours by road.
Explore the picturesque Kalpa Village, known for its apple orchards and stunning views of Kinnaur Kailash. Take a leisurely walk through the village lanes.
